Mawgan Porth is now one of the most sought after locations in North Cornwall. The magnificent sandy beach is famous for water sports activities serving surfers and bathers alike with stunning cliff and coastline walks. Fine dining is available locally at the award-winning Scarlet Hotel as well as first class spa and recreational facilities at The Scarlet & Bedruthan Hotel. The bay provides a range of amenities including a local store, cafes, various eateries, The Merrymoor public house, surf school and gift shops. Walkers are well placed to enjoy the wonders of the South West Coastal Path with fabulous walks to the likes of Watergate Bay and Bedruthan Steps being within easy reach. Rick Stein's esteemed Seafood restaurant, Paul Ainsworth's Michelin starred No.6 and cool seafood bar Prawn On The Lawn in picturesque Padstow can be found just a few miles distant. Well situated for ease of transport, Mawgan Porth is less than a 20 minute drive off the main A30 and approximately 2.4 miles from Newquay Airport with its domestic and international flight services. The main line train station at Bodmin Parkway is an approximate 30 minutes drive away with routes into London Paddington.
